Meta says the Meta AI conversational assistant will be found in many forms across WhatsApp, Messenger and Instagram, and is based on broad language models and a partnership with the Bing search engine.

The company launched 28 chatbots with the latest version of artificial intelligence that will talk like celebrities (such as Snoop Dogg, Tom Brady, Kendall Jenner, Paris Hilton and Naomi Osaka).

Mark Zuckerberg says you can talk to these chatbots, and from 2024 some of them will also have a voice, so conversations won’t just be written.

“Most people haven’t had the opportunity to experience the latest and most powerful AI technologies,” Mark Zuckerberg, Meta’s chief executive, said Wednesday. “I think that’s one thing we can change.”

“Users will not want to interact with just one AI. are very smart, they will want to interact with many different chatbots,” says the Meta boss.

Facebook hopes these chatbots will be widely used because it will mean more “engagement”: people will use more of Meta’s apps and spend more time in its products, most of which rely on ads to make money. More time spent in Meta apps means more ads will be shown to users.

Facebook has been working on AI applications for years, but has yet to release generative AI chatbots, and Zuckerberg has decided in the fall of 2021 to direct the company to create a virtual universe called Metavers.

Zuckerberg had to “change the game” after the success of ChatGPT forced all major companies to accelerate the release of conversational bots.

It is not clear whether Meta can make money from these chatbots, but it has several advantages: a huge audience (over three billion people use the apps in total) and a very good financial position).
